Practice makes perfect, smaller talks won't hurt your chances for larger venues but it may eat up your time. And a lot of time is needed in order to generate the material for a tech talk such that you have something interesting to convey and are able to back it up within the appropriate context.

In terms of presentation, some good advice I have heard is to present as if the audience are not native english speakers.
